Understanding Triacin C: Uses and Benefits
What is Triacin C?
Triacin C is a prescription medication that is often used in the treatment of various medical conditions. It is composed of a combination of three active ingredients: triamcinolone acetonide, neomycin sulfate, and gramicidin. Each of these components serves a specific purpose in the efficacy of Triacin C.
Triamcinolone acetonide belongs to a group of drugs known as corticosteroids. It works by reducing inflammation and suppressing the immune system’s response to certain conditions.
Neomycin sulfate, on the other hand, is an antibiotic that helps to prevent or treat bacterial infections.
Lastly, gramicidin is an antibiotic as well and is effective against a broad range of bacteria.
Medical Conditions Treated by Triacin C
Triacin C is primarily prescribed for conditions that require anti-inflammatory and antibiotic treatments. It is commonly used in dermatology for skin conditions such as eczema, psoriasis, and dermatitis, where inflammation and infection may be present.
Furthermore, Triacin C can be used in other areas of the body where these specific conditions occur, such as the ears, eyes, and mouth.
It’s important to note that Triacin C should only be used as prescribed by a healthcare professional and should not be used for conditions not indicated by your doctor.
The Benefits of Triacin C
The combination of three active ingredients in Triacin C provides numerous benefits for patients. By reducing inflammation, Triacin C helps to relieve symptoms such as redness, itching, and swelling. Additionally, the presence of antibiotics aids in combating any bacterial infections that may exist.
This medication can have a significant impact on the daily lives of individuals suffering from conditions such as eczema, psoriasis, and dermatitis, offering relief and promoting healing.

Health Insurance Basics
How Health Insurance Works
Health insurance is a contract between an individual or their employer and an insurance company. It provides financial coverage for medical expenses in exchange for monthly premiums. The specifics of health insurance policies can vary, but they typically include coverage for essential medical services, including prescription drugs.
Health insurance operates on the principle of risk sharing. Policyholders pay premiums, and in return, the insurance company provides coverage for a wide range of medical services. In the case of prescription drugs, different health insurance policies may have varying coverage levels and restrictions, including the specific drugs covered and the amount of out-of-pocket costs.
Types of Health Insurance Coverage
There are different types of health insurance coverage, including employer-sponsored plans, government programs like Medicaid and Medicare, and individual health insurance plans.
Employer-sponsored plans are those offered by employers to their employees as part of their benefits package. These plans are usually negotiated between the employer and the insurance company.
Government programs like Medicaid provide health insurance to low-income individuals and families, while Medicare caters to individuals aged 65 and older, as well as those with certain disabilities.
Individual health insurance plans are purchased directly by individuals or families from insurance companies, providing coverage for medical services, including prescription drugs.
Does Health Insurance Cover Prescription Drugs?
Prescription drugs play a crucial role in the management and treatment of various medical conditions. Therefore, it is essential to understand the extent of health insurance coverage for these medications, including drugs like Triacin C.
Prescription Drug Coverage Explained
Prescription drug coverage refers to the portion of a health insurance policy that covers the cost of prescription medications. While most health insurance plans provide some level of coverage for prescription drugs, the specifics can vary.
Some health insurance plans may have a formulary, which is a list of preferred drugs that are covered at a lower cost or with a lower out-of-pocket expense. Drugs that are not on the formulary may have limited coverage or require higher out-of-pocket costs.
It’s important to review your health insurance policy or contact your insurance provider to understand the specific details of your prescription drug coverage.
Factors Affecting Drug Coverage
Several factors can influence the extent of coverage for prescription drugs like Triacin C under your health insurance plan:
- The specific health insurance plan you have.
- The formulary of your health insurance plan.
- The tier level assigned to Triacin C in the formulary (higher-tier drugs often have higher costs).
- Whether or not Triacin C is considered medically necessary for your condition.
Understanding these factors can help you better assess how much your health insurance will cover for Triacin C and what out-of-pocket costs you may be responsible for.

What to Do if Your Health Insurance Doesn’t Cover Triacin C
Alternative Treatment Options
In cases where your health insurance does not cover Triacin C or the out-of-pocket costs are prohibitively high, it may be necessary to explore alternative treatment options. Your healthcare provider can work with you to identify alternative medications that are covered by your health insurance plan.
Alternatively, they may be able to recommend non-prescription alternatives or other therapies that can help manage your condition effectively.
It’s crucial to prioritize open communication with your healthcare provider to find the best possible solution for your medical needs within the constraints of your health insurance coverage.
Patient Assistance Programs for Triacin C
If the out-of-pocket costs for Triacin C are a concern, patient assistance programs may provide a viable solution. These programs, offered by pharmaceutical companies, nonprofit organizations, or government agencies, aim to help individuals afford the medications they need.
Through patient assistance programs, eligible individuals can receive Triacin C at reduced or no cost. These programs typically have specific eligibility criteria and application processes, which may involve providing proof of income and other relevant documentation.
Reach out to your healthcare provider or conduct research online to explore patient assistance programs that may be available for Triacin C.
